Despite being a niche career domain, the opportunities available for forensic scientists and forensic specialists are quite lucrative. Thanks to the lack of fierce competition, the field offers attractive job openings with handsome pay in both, the government and the private sectors.
Government Sector : Different departments in the Government sector and law-enforcement agencies are the largest recruiters of forensic scientists in India. Students who have completed M.Sc in Forensic science are eligible to apply for different posts related to forensic science at the state or Central Forensic Science Laboratories.
Private Sector : For forensic scientists, career opportunities in the private sector are limited, as compared to the ones available in the government sector. Students can take up contractual work with private investigative agencies or as independent experts after completing their Diploma, Certificate, B.Sc or M.Sc in forensic science.
Teaching : For candidates who are not really comfortable with investigation of crimes, teaching can be another interesting career option in forensic science. There are only a handful of institutes that offer academic programs in forensic science; at the same time, the teachers and trainers who are experts in this field are also limited.

Forensic science , also known as criminalistics, is the application of science to criminal and civil laws, mainly—on the criminal side—during criminal investigation, as governed by the legal standards of admissible evidence and criminal procedure.

The minimum eligibility for admission into Msc Forensic Science is to hold a bachelors degree with a minimum aggregate of 60%.The minimum marks in graduation varies in institutes.Some of the institutes offer admission based on the marks in the qualifying examination. Some may conduct entrance tests to give admission to the deserved candidates.You are requested to go through the guidelines provided by the college for the admission.

B.Sc in Forensic Science is a three-year undergraduate program which offers the study of scientific applications and knowledge that helps in the investigation of crimes.
The admission to B.Sc Forensic Science course is done in two ways:
Merit-Based: The merit-based admission to the course is done directly on the basis of score obtained by the candidate in the qualifying examination. Some colleges also prepare a cutoff list based on the qualifying examination for admission.
Entrance Based: The entrance based admission to the course is done on the basis of score obtained by the candidate in a national level, state level or college level entrance exams. The admission is done through the counselling process.
